We are excited to be recruiting for Production Operatives on behalf of our client based in Silverstone. This role is temp to perm so after 12 weeks you will be taken on as a permanent member of staff!

As a Production Operative your role will include:

  • Working with hand tools such as nail guns
  • Working with heavy tools

The hours of work for the Production Operative role will be:

  • Monday to Friday 07:45-16:30

Possibility for bonus which is capped at £100 per week by exceeding daily targets.

Weekday Overtime paid at £16.52 per hour.

Saturday overtime paid at £19.06 - £25.42 per hour.

To be a successful Production Operative, you will:

  • Have experience in the timber industry
  • Have experience in manufacturing
  • Be confident working with tools
  • Be fit and healthy
  • Be able to work on your feet all day
  • Speak and understand English
